[Nemaline myopathy: an unusual course]

Summary
A newborn girl presented with severe hypotonia, but a muscle biopsy at age two revealed a mild form of nemaline myopathy, defying typical severe outcomes for neonatal onset.

Background:
- Neonatal hypotonia, or floppy infant syndrome, presents significant diagnostic challenges.
- Early identification and characterization of neuromuscular disorders are crucial for prognosis.
- Nemaline myopathy is a congenital myopathy with variable clinical severity.
Observation:
- A neonate exhibited severe muscular hypotonia, reduced sucking/swallowing, and drooling.
- Initial screening tests (muscle enzymes, EMG, NCV) were largely normal, with only a slight aldolase elevation.
- Physical examination revealed broad alveolar ridges suggesting a high-arched palate.
Findings:
- Muscle biopsy at two years confirmed nemaline myopathy.
- Despite severe neonatal hypotonia, the patient appears to have a mild disease course.
- This contrasts with the typically severe and often lethal outcomes associated with neonatal-onset nemaline myopathy.
Implications:
- This case highlights the potential for milder nemaline myopathy presentations despite severe neonatal hypotonia.
- It underscores the importance of muscle biopsy for definitive diagnosis in congenital hypotonia.
- Further research is needed to understand the factors influencing disease severity in nemaline myopathy.
